HPLC法测定深层液体发酵桑黄菌丝体粉中麦角甾醇的含量

Determination of Ergosterol in Deep Fermented Mycelium Powder of Phellinus igniarius by HPLC

摘要: 目的:建立高效液相色谱(HPLC)法测定桑黄发酵菌丝体粉中麦角甾醇的含量。方法:采用甲醇超声提取菌粉中的麦角甾醇,色谱柱为Welch Mltimate LP-C18柱(4.6 mm×250 mm,5 μm),流动相为甲醇∶水(98∶2),流速1 mL·min-1,检测波长 283 nm,柱温30 ℃。结果:在进样量为0.100 721~1.007 214 μg(r2=0.999 9)范围内,麦角甾醇的浓度与峰面积具有良好的线性关系;平均加样回收率为98.02% (RSD 0.80%)。结论:该检测方法准确可靠,重复性好,可操作性强,可用于深层液体发酵桑黄菌丝体粉中麦角甾醇的含量测定,同时也为麦角甾醇列入桑黄发酵菌丝体粉的质量标准提供依据。

Abstract: Objective:To establish a HPLC method for the determination of ergosterol in deep fermented mycelium powder of Phellinus igniarius. Methods: Using methanol to extract ergosterol from mycelium powdeer by rultrasound, the chromatographic column was Welch Μltimate LP-C18(4.6 mm×250 mm, 5 μm)with methanol∶water(98∶2) as the mobile phase at a flow rate of 1 mL·min-1. The detection wavelength was 283 nm, and the column temperature was 30 ℃. Results:There was a good linear relationship between concentration and peak area within the range of 0.100 721-1.007 21 μg(r2=0.999 9). The average recovery rate was 98.02% (RSD 0.80% ). Conclusion:The method is accurate, reliable, easy operation and repeatable.It can be used to determine the content of ergosterol in deep fermented mycelium powder of Phellinus igniarius and also provide reference for ergosterol as the quality standards of Phellinus igniarius fermented mycelium powder.
